An established research institution is seeking a Postdoctoral Associate to explore the intricate roles of visual and cognitive processes in eye movements. This position offers the opportunity to engage in innovative research focused on perceptual cues and learning, utilizing advanced methodologies to analyze and model eye movement behavior. Candidates will collaborate in a dynamic environment, contributing to groundbreaking studies that enhance our understanding of cognition and perception. If you possess a doctoral degree in a relevant field and have strong programming and analytical skills, this role presents an exciting chance to make a significant impact in the field.

Minimum Education and Experience | Doctoral degree in Psychology (Cognitive or Perception or related area), Neuroscience, or Engineering Knowledge of computer programming Knowledge of statistical methods and related software |
---|---|
Certifications/Licenses | |
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ities | The original research requires an individual who has experience designing, carrying out and reporting projects of comparable complexity and in the same disciplinary area as the research in the Eye Movements, Vision and Cognition Lab. This is necessary so that the individual can participate at a high level in the design of the projects, in running the experiments, in analyzing and modeling the data, and in reporting the results through talks or manuscripts with a considerable degree of independence. Programming skills in Matlab and Python. Experience using advanced statistical methods for analyzing and modeling data Experience designing and running psychophysical or eye movement experiements with human subjects Experience preparing presenations and manuscripts Basic knowledge of eye movements Basic knowledge of psychophysical methods |
